Outcomes of patients with acute ST-elevation myocardial infarction (STEMI) are directly related to reperfusion time. Effect of transradial approach (left vs right) on reperfusion time has not been fully studied for SETMI patients undergoing primary percutaneous coronary intervention (PCI). The aim of this study was to randomly investigate the efficacy and safety of left radial approach for primary PCI in STEMI patients compared with right radial approach.
The investigators will enroll consecutively for 3 years all STEMI patients undergoing primary PCI. Patients will be included within 12 hours of symptom onset for primary PCI. Patients will be excluded if they are in cardiogenic shock.
